What Makes Culinary Travel Trips So Special?
Connecting Culture Through Food
Food tells the story of a place—its history, its people, and its traditions. Culinary travel gives you a chance to understand a community from the inside out. You’re not just tasting dishes; you’re learning their meaning.

Trip 1: Farm-to-Table Retreats at Zero-Waste Organic Farms
Immersive Cooking Experiences
One of the most rewarding Culinary Travel Trips is spending time directly on working organic farms. You harvest ingredients, cook alongside expert chefs, and share meals with fellow travelers who care about sustainability.

Trip 2: Organic Farm Tours & Workshops
Meet the Farmers Behind the Food
You’ll discover how communities grow organic food responsibly and how regenerative agriculture protects ecosystems.
Sustainable Food Education in Real Time
Workshops teach composting, seed saving, and soil health—core elements of sustainable food education.

Final Tips for Planning Culinary Travel Trips
How to Travel with a Zero-Waste Mindset
Carry reusable cutlery, cloth bags, water bottles, and containers to reduce single-use waste.
